Delaware Car Insurance
Delaware drivers are required by law to carry several different types of auto insurance coverage. Delaware drivers must have auto liability coverage at a minimum of $15,00 for one person, $30,000 for all parties in an accident for bodily injuries and $10,000 of minimum coverage for property damage. This amount of coverage may be more simply stated on an auto insurance policy as 15/30/10.
PIP Coverage
Personal Injury Protection ("PIP") is no fault coverage that is required by law in Delaware. PIP pays for "reasonable and necessary" medical bills for the insured driver and their passengers in an accident. It also pays for a portion of lost wages. The minimum PIP coverage limit in Delaware is $15,000 per person, $30,000 per accident. This coverage also pays for up to $5,000 in funeral expenses in the event of a fatality accident.
PIP is the primary form of medical coverage for an auto accident in Delaware. If medical expenses exhaust the PIP limits, the insured can then bill remaining amounts to their health insurer. Delaware drivers should carefully review their auto insurance policy to understand its terms, coverage amounts, and limitations.
UIM Coverage
Although it is not required by Delaware law, purchasing Uninsured/Underinsured Motorist ("UIM") coverage is a very wise decision. UIM coverage applies in the event the at–fault driver in an accident is uninsured or does not have enough insurance to pay for the damages sustained by the other driver(s) or passengers in the accident. While $30,000 in total coverage for bodily injury damages may seem like a lot of money, it can be used up quickly in a serious injury accident or accident involving multiple parties.
For example, if a Delaware driver in an accident had 15/30/10 UIM coverage, he or she would be able make a UIM claim with their auto insurance company and when applicable, be able to receive up to an additional $25,000 for their own bodily injury damages. A UIM claim would be valid if the at fault driver was uninsured or the UIM insured sustained bodily injury damages beyond the limits of the at fault driver's liability limits. Per the UIM policy limits, the insurer would only pay up to $50,000 for all UIM bodily injury claims stemming from the accident. The insured would also be able to receive up to $10,000 for property damage to their vehicle under a UIM claim.
Collision and Comprehensive Coverage
Other important available insurance coverage types in Delaware are Collision and Comprehensive coverage. These coverage types are not required by law but can be very important in the event of an accident. Also, many financial institutions require vehicle owners to purchase collision and comprehensive coverage as a condition of their loans.
Collision pays for vehicle repairs or vehicle replacement value following a collision regardless of fault. Comprehensive coverage pays for all vehicle repair damage or replacement value for incidents other than a collision such as the tree falling on a car or the car being stolen. There are minimum deductible limits for these collision and comprehensive such as $500, but drivers can also raise their deductible amounts to lower their premiums.
Keep Your Car Insurance Current
It is very important that Delaware drivers do not allow their auto insurance policies to lapse. Each day, hundreds of Delaware drivers are involved in auto accidents. Uninsured drivers in Delaware have to pay fines and may be forced to comply with state financial responsibility laws, which require them to purchase expensive SR–22 Insurance. Uninsured or underinsured drivers can also be held personally responsible for all damages caused in an accident. Driving without car insurance in Delaware is extremely risky and can lead to financial ruin.
